Convene Salary Survey 2017

PCMA Convene

Respondents with a CMP earned on average around $10,500 a year more than their colleagues without the designation: $86,847 versus $76,253. Seventy-one percent of respondents are satisfied with their specific jobs, and 87 percent said that they are satisfied with the meetings profession as a whole.
